使用SFTP进行远程登录的步骤如下:
方法一:通过SSH隧道连接
-
安装SSH客户端:
- 在Windows上,可以使用PuTTY。
- 在Linux或macOS上,SSH客户端通常已经预装。
-
打开SSH客户端:
- 在PuTTY中,输入远程服务器的IP地址和端口号(通常是22)。
- 点击“Open”开始连接。
-
输入用户名和密码:
-
启动SFTP会话:
- 登录成功后,在命令行界面输入
sftp username@hostname,其中username是你的用户名,hostname是服务器的主机名或IP地址。
- 按回车键,你将进入SFTP命令模式。
-
使用SFTP命令:
ls:列出当前目录下的文件和文件夹。
cd directory:切换到指定目录。
get filename:下载文件到本地。
put localfile:上传文件到服务器。
mkdir directory:创建新目录。
rmdir directory:删除空目录。
exit:退出SFTP会话。
方法二:直接使用SFTP客户端软件
-
下载并安装SFTP客户端软件:
-
配置连接:
- 打开SFTP客户端软件。
- 点击“新建站点”或“添加连接”。
- 输入远程服务器的IP地址、端口号、用户名和密码。
- 配置其他选项,如加密方式、密钥文件等。
-
连接服务器:
- 点击“连接”按钮,软件会尝试连接到远程服务器。
- 连接成功后,你可以在客户端的界面中浏览和管理文件。
注意事项
- 安全性:确保使用强密码,并考虑使用SSH密钥进行身份验证以提高安全性。
- 防火墙设置:确保服务器的防火墙允许SFTP流量通过端口22。
- 权限管理:确保你有足够的权限访问和操作远程服务器上的文件和目录。
通过以上步骤,你可以轻松地使用SFTP进行远程登录和文件传输。